North Notts College Celebrates New Four Million Pounds Facilities
North Notts College celebrated its new ยฃ4m T Level (Digital, Health, Childcare and Joinery) and Hair and Beauty facilities and salon by hosting a launch event on Thursday 6th February.
North Notts College part of the RNN Group (made up of campuses including Rotherham College, North Notts College, Dearne Valley College and University Centre Rotherham (UCR)) consolidated all of its learning onto the one campus following the opening of this state-of-the-art centre for T Levels including early years and education, health and social care and digital and joinery alongside a brand new hair and beauty centre and salon – including medical aesthetics – for both students, staff and the public to enjoy.
RNN Group of colleges have seen an increase in applications for the start of 2024/25 college year for T Level subjects and our new facilities will support learners in these and other programmes of study.
Richard Bond Deputy Lord Lieutenant officially opened the new facilities at the event which included networking, a presentation, tours of the new facilities and taster sessions in many of the new areas as well as the important cutting of the ribbon.
Local employers, organisations, stakeholders, governors, staff, parents and students were among those present to enjoy the celebration and view the new facilities showcased by our learnersโ hosting activities.
